在当今这个信息爆炸的时代,网页与C语言作为两大热门技术,正逐渐融合,为我国互联网行业带来了前所未有的机遇。本文将从网页与C语言的关系、融合优势、创新实践等方面展开论述,以期为广大读者提供有益的参考。
一、网页与C语言的关系
网页,作为互联网信息传播的重要载体,具有丰富的表现形式和便捷的交互性。而C语言,作为一种高效、可靠的编程语言,在系统开发、嵌入式等领域有着广泛的应用。二者看似毫无关联,实则存在着紧密的联系。
1. 网页开发中的C语言应用
在网页开发过程中,C语言发挥着重要作用。例如,在服务器端编程中,C语言可以用于编写高性能的服务器程序,如Apache、Nginx等。C语言在处理图像、音频、视频等媒体数据时,具有显著优势。
2. C语言在网页前端的应用
在网页前端,C语言主要用于编写游戏、动画等高性能应用。例如,著名游戏引擎Unreal Engine就是基于C++(C语言的一种扩展)开发的。C语言还可以用于编写HTML、CSS等网页前端技术。
二、网页与C语言的融合优势
1. 提高网页性能
将C语言应用于网页开发,可以显著提高网页性能。例如,使用C语言编写的服务器程序,相较于其他编程语言,具有更低的延迟、更高的吞吐量。
2. 丰富网页功能
C语言在处理图像、音频、视频等媒体数据方面具有优势,将其应用于网页开发,可以丰富网页功能,提升用户体验。
3. 跨平台兼容性
C语言具有跨平台兼容性,可以轻松实现网页在不同操作系统、浏览器之间的运行。
三、创新实践
1. 高性能网页服务器
利用C语言编写高性能的网页服务器,如Apache、Nginx等,可以提高网站访问速度,降低服务器负载。
2. 基于C语言的网页游戏
结合C语言的高性能特点,开发网页游戏,如《刀塔传奇》、《穿越火线》等,吸引了大量用户。
3. C语言在WebAssembly中的应用
WebAssembly(简称Wasm)是一种新兴的网页技术,旨在提高网页性能。C语言在Wasm中的应用,可以使得网页运行速度更快、更稳定。
网页与C语言的融合,为我国互联网行业带来了新的机遇。在创新实践中,我们要充分发挥C语言的优势,为用户提供更加优质、高效的网页服务。也要关注新技术的发展,推动网页与C语言的深度融合,助力我国互联网产业的繁荣发展。
引用权威资料:
1. 《WebAssembly:新一代网页技术》,作者:李忠,出版社:电子工业出版社。
2. 《高性能服务器编程》,作者:高文,出版社:电子工业出版社。